Qatar is advancing the Kawader digital employment platform to accelerate Qatarisation and align national talent with private sector needs.

Doha, June 13, 2026 — Qatar is accelerating its Qatarisation efforts with the advancement of Kawader, a sophisticated digital employment platform designed to increase the participation of Qatari nationals in the private sector workforce.

The platform serves as a centralized hub that connects qualified Qatari talent — including children of Qatari women — with evolving labor market demands, while bringing greater transparency, efficiency, and consistency to recruitment processes across both public and private sectors.

What is Kawader and How Does It Work?

Kawader (meaning “cadres” or “talent pools” in Arabic) functions as a national talent-matching system. Key features include:

  • Centralized Job Posting: Private and public sector companies can advertise vacancies directly on the platform.

  • Verified Candidate Database: Qatari nationals and eligible children of Qatari women can create detailed profiles showcasing their qualifications, skills, work experience, and career preferences.

  • Smart Matching: The system uses data-driven tools to align candidates with suitable opportunities based on market needs.

  • Progress Tracking: Employers can monitor their Qatarisation compliance and hiring metrics in real time.

  • Streamlined Recruitment: Reduces reliance on fragmented hiring channels and promotes fairer, more transparent selection processes.

By centralizing these activities, Kawader aims to make it easier for companies to meet Qatarisation targets while helping Qatari job seekers find meaningful employment in the private sector.

Strategic Importance for Qatar’s Economy

Qatarisation remains a national priority under Qatar National Vision 2030. The government continues to push for greater participation of nationals in the private sector to reduce dependency on expatriate labor and build a more sustainable, knowledge-based economy.

The Kawader platform supports this goal by:

  • Addressing skills gaps in key industries

  • Improving workforce localization rates

  • Encouraging private sector companies to invest in Qatari talent development

  • Enhancing overall labor market efficiency

Broader Context of Qatarisation in 2026

Kawader represents the latest digital initiative in Qatar’s long-term strategy to empower nationals in the workforce. The platform complements other efforts such as training programs, sector-specific localization targets, and incentives for companies that exceed Qatarisation goals.

As Qatar continues to diversify its economy beyond hydrocarbons, initiatives like Kawader play a crucial role in building a competitive, locally-driven private sector.
